My tenant wanted to pay through Cozy so he could automate payments and I stupidly agreed without doing much research into the site. So he paid the security deposit, first month rent and cleaning deposit via Cozy. I gave him the keys and he moved in. 2 days later, he reversed the payments (before Cozy sent them to my bank account) and then closed his bank account. So, now I have this weasel in my condo with a signed lease and I have ZERO dollars. Cozy offers ZERO support. I got an eviction judgment on the guy today and found out that he had been evicted the month before and ran the exact same scam (via Cozy) on the prior landlord.

I was looking for a program that will give me an opportunity to collect rents electronically. I wasn't interested in backgrounds check or credit reports or accounting and bookkeeping. I just wanted an electronic rent collection. I was tired of going to the bank to deposit handwritten paper checks and then deal with returned checks due to illegible handwriting. A bill payment online was the same drag, just legible. Cozy was my first and my only choice for that matter because it offered me what I was after. First of all, it's free to both sides - tenants and landlords (I am not talking about rent payments by credit cards, everybody charges for that service) and secondly, because it's Cozy's best feature, in my opinion, i. E. electronic rent collection and electronic deposit. It does exactly what I need: collects rent electronically from tenants' accounts and deposits those rent payments electronically to my account that I have registered with Cozy. I've been using Cozy since January of 2019 and there were never been lost or misplaced rent deposits. My tenants, who are a quite fussy crowd, don't have any complains about incorrect withdrawals from their accounts either. Everybody is happy. The tenants actually love the convenience of free of charge recurring rent pmnts. When tenants move out they simply need to stop their rent payments withdrawals on Cozy's website. If they forget to do that or won't do it on time and the rent payment does get collected, I simply return that overpayment to them. Cozy informs me when the rents get withdrawn from the tenants accounts - I get an email from Cozy indicating the date of withdrawal, the tenant's name and the amount. On the same day when I get that email from Cozy, I also see tenants' rent payments as pending deposits in my bank account. Great, isn'it? That's exactly what I wanted from a program: rents coming out of tenants' account and going directly to my account. I do my own verifications and investigation of prospective tenants. I don't use Cozy or any other program for that and if I screw up (happened once in my 19 years of being a landlord, I learned from my mistakes) there is no one to blame but me. I will not trust to do that to any software. There are many faucets to each of the verification steps, that process is very important and requires human interaction.
So, why did I give Cozy only 3 stars? Because it's not a very flexible program. While some Cozy's features are useful, like automatic late fees or suggestion to tenants to buy tenants insurance, some features are confusing because in order to use them one needs to jump through the hoops. When it comes to leases renewal on their website, I don't even bother. I don't indicate the beginning and the end of a lease anymore, I simply show on their website that all my leases are month to month. When a lease expires I simply change the rent amount on Cozy's website and the tenant changes his or her new rent amount to be withdrawn on Cozy's website accordingly. And yes, there is no telephone customer service, which is annoying when you have a question which could be resolved in a couple of minutes. But they are pretty good in replying to my emails.
